SkiFree (ski32.exe, Microsoft Entertainment Pack)

test/binaries/entertainment-pack/ski32.exe, app id ski32. Image base 0x400000; single module, no DLLs of its own, so runtime VA == original VA (nothing here needs module+0x arithmetic).

Everything below is read straight out of the binary with the repo's own tools; the commands are given so each number can be re-derived rather than trusted.

Window class and wndproc

node tools/pe-imports.js test/binaries/entertainment-pack/ski32.exe --dll=USER32
node tools/disasm_fn.js test/binaries/entertainment-pack/ski32.exe 0x405440 90

USER32's IAT starts at 0x40a100. RegisterClassA is import [1] (0x40a104), called once at 0x4054dd; the WNDCLASS it fills sits on the stack and takes style = 0x2023 and lpfnWndProc = 0x405800.

VA What
0x405800 main wndproc
0x405986, 0x406924 the two call [0x40a150] (DefWindowProcA) sites

0x405800 splits three ways: msg <= 0x24 goes through a jump table at 0x4059c4/0x4059e0; above that, 0x405915 compares against 0x200 and peels off WM_KEYDOWN and WM_CHAR by subtraction:

00405915  cmp eax, 0x200
0040591a  ja  0x405986          ; -> DefWindowProc
0040591c  jz  0x405969          ; WM_MOUSEMOVE
0040591e  mov ecx, eax
00405920  sub ecx, 0x100
00405926  jz  0x40594d          ; WM_KEYDOWN -> call 0x406170
00405928  sub ecx, 0x2
0040592b  jnz 0x405995          ; default
0040592d  ...                   ; WM_CHAR   -> call 0x406780

WM_CHAR is never spelled as the literal 0x102. A byte search for the constant (node tools/find_bytes.js … --imm32=0x102) returns 0 hits and reads as "this app does not use WM_CHAR", which is wrong — the subtract chain above is how it tests for it. Do not conclude anything from the absence of a message constant in this binary.

Keyboard: two tables, and the character one is where the game lives

WM_KEYDOWN — 0x406170

00406170  lea eax, [ecx-0xd]      ; ecx = wParam (virtual key)
00406174  cmp eax, 0x65
00406177  ja  0x4061b1            ; default
0040617b  mov dl, [eax+0x4063bc]  ; slot index, vk 0x0d..0x72
00406181  jmp [0x4063a8+edx*4]    ; five arms

Dump both tables with node tools/dump_va.js test/binaries/entertainment-pack/ski32.exe 0x4063bc 102 and … 0x4063a8 20. Slot 4 is the default arm (0x4061b1), and only four virtual keys are anything else:

vk key arm
0x0d RETURN 0x40619e
0x1b ESCAPE 0x406188
0x71 F2 0x4061ab
0x72 F3 0x406198

That is the complete virtual-key vocabulary. There are no arrow keys: the skier follows the mouse pointer, which is why the app's touch layout has no dpad.

WM_CHAR — 0x406780

00406780  lea eax, [ecx-0x58]     ; ecx = wParam (character)
00406783  cmp eax, 0x21
00406786  ja  0x40684a            ; bare `ret`
0040678e  mov cl, [eax+0x40686c]  ; slot index, chars 0x58..0x79
00406794  jmp [0x40684c+ecx*4]

The table covers characters 0x580x79 only, and slot 7 is the do-nothing arm. Everything the game exposes to the keyboard beyond the four keys above is here, and all of it is case-sensitive by construction — 'F' (0x46) is below the range and is discarded before the table is even consulted.

char arm What
'f' 0x66 0x4067a0 toggles the speed flag at 0x40c670 (setz dl of its own value — a toggle, not a hold)
'r' 0x72 0x4067b3 tail-calls 0x401060 with [0x40c63c] and 0x40c6b0
't' 0x74 0x40679b jmp 0x401000
'x' 0x78 0x4067c3 moves the object at [0x40c72c] (fields +0x40/+0x42/+0x44) by +2 on one axis via 0x402390
'X' 0x58 0x4067e5 same, -2
'y' 0x79 0x406807 same, other axis +2
'Y' 0x59 0x406829 same, other axis -2

Named data

VA What
0x40c670 speed ("fast") flag, 0 or 1, toggled by 'f'
0x40c67c set once the game object exists; both key handlers bail when it is 0
0x40c72c pointer to the object 'x'/'y' reposition

Reproduction: proving the speed key works

Speed is a rate, so no screenshot can show it. Watch the flag instead:

node test/run.js --app=ski32 --quiet-api --no-close \
  --max-batches=900 --max-seconds=120 \
  --watch=0x40c670 --watch-log \
  --input='300:keydown:0x46,320:keyup:0x46,500:keypress:0x66,700:keypress:0x66'

Measured 2026-09-13: the watchpoint fires at batches 500 and 701 (the two characters) and never in the 300–500 window (the virtual key). --input's keypress: action is the one that produces WM_CHAR; keydown:/keyup: never do — see lib/renderer-input.js, where handleKeyPress is a separate entry point that the browser's own keypress event drives.
